Denver St - streets of Rowlett (Texas).
Explore "Denver St" on the map of Rowlett in street view mode
Click on the buttons below to display the map of Denver St, Rowlett, United States
Search street by name:
Tags:
Denver St on the map of Rowlett,
Rowlett satellite view, Rowlett street view.